Starter problems of the 2008 Chevrolet Suburban

One problem related to starter has been reported for the 2008 Chevrolet Suburban. The most recently reported issues are listed below.

1 Starter problem

Failure Date: 12/22/2011

Driving the car on city street, let off gas to slow down, engine shudders, the instrument console flashes, indicates engine power decreasing, the radio stops working, the vehicle loses power, the stabilitrac indicates it needs to be serviced, gives rear camera/towing warning, the engine dies, brakes are lost. Immediately after engines dies starter will not crank. The car will start again after several minutes. Check engine light is on. After a drive of about 4 miles parked car and started next morning--check engine light is off. Engine quitting and no brakes could be dangerous. Intermittent problem.
